Hide or Save?

15Then the kings of the earth, the princes, the generals, the rich, the mighty, and everyone else, both slave and free, hid in caves and among the rocks of the mountains. 16They called to the mountains and the rocks, “Fall on us and hide us  from the face of him who sits on the throne and from the wrath of the Lamb! 17For the great day of their  wrath has come, and who can withstand it?”–Revelation 6

Since we have now been justified by his [Jesus’] blood, how much more shall we be saved from God’s wrath through him! (Romans 5:9)

  1. In John’s vision, Jesus had opened the first six seals of God’s unfolding, end-times plan.
  2. God’s wrath was being poured out on sin.
  3. You either belong to Christ and have had your sins forgiven or you have not.
  4. If you have, the blood of Jesus saves you from God’s wrath.
  5. If you have not, the best thing you can ask for is to hide from God’s wrath.
  6. It all depends on Jesus. You are either saying “Save me!” or you are calling out. “Hide me!”
  7. Which is your story? It’s not too late to trust Jesus alone for your salvation.–JMB
